Mac Mini leaked packaging?
We’ve been hearing a lot of whispers about the Mac mini as of late, and we’ve brushed a number of them off as fake. But it seems that either this is one of the most elaborate hoaxes we’ve come across in a long time, or this is actually the next Mac mini.

Just taking a brief look at the image, it’s your standard crappy camera phone image, but it lines up perfectly with the earlier leaked Mac mini images and Mac mini video. I feel pretty confident when I say this image is very likely (say, 99% sure) not Photoshopped. Why do I say that? Well, it’s dead simple to fake packaging. Here, let me outline the steps for you.

  1. Find a box, preferably of appropriate size.
  2. Take the image you found of the Mac mini online, extract it and put it against a white background.
  3. Slap an Apple logo somewhere on there, and make it look consistent with Apple packaging. This means semi-extreme minimalism.
  4. Print the image, and put it on the box from step 1.
  5. Shrink wrap the box.
  6. Find a 5 year old camera, turn off half the lights in the room, and make sure there’s at least one light reflecting off the object You know, so no one thinks it’s Photoshopped.

Ok, so I’m done having my fun with how to fake packaging, but the truth is that I’m not completely ruling this out as fake. When a lot of rumors tend to line up like this, I start to believe them.
